Healthcare Coding Courses
Embarking on a path in medical coding requires proper certification. Numerous healthcare coding courses are available, ranging from introductory workshops to comprehensive credentials. These courses typically cover topics such as ICD-X, CPT, and HCPCS billing & coding guidelines, along with essential knowledge in medical terminology and documentation. Certain offer online options for convenient learning, while others are offered in a traditional classroom format. Consider your training style and goals when selecting the appropriate program for you. Ultimately, a solid foundation in healthcare coding is necessary for success in this growing field.
